From sea to shining sea is a American saying meaning from the Pacific Ocean to the Atlantic Ocean (or, indeed, vice versa). Many songs used this term, including American patriotic songs "America, The Beautiful" and "God Bless the USA". In addition to these, it is also featured in Schoolhouse Rock's "Elbow Room". Although the United States has borders with the Arctic Ocean and the Gulf of Mexico, the phrase refers only to the West and East coast of "Continental U.S.".
